One dead in motorcycle accident on northbound I-95 Thursday morning

FORT LAUDERDALE - A section of northbound I-95 was shut down for hours on Thursday after a fatal accident involving two motorcycles.

According to Florida Highway Patrol, around 3 a.m., a 36-year-old Tamarac man was riding a BMW motorcycle when he went down south of Sunrise Boulevard and slid over several lanes. He then lost contact with his bike, slid over one more lane, and was run over by several vehicles. He died.

A 43-year-old Pompano Beach woman on a Yamaha motorcycle hit the man's bike, which caught fire, and flew off her bike. She suffered leg injuries.

During the morning commute, all northbound and express lanes between Broward Boulevard and Sunrise Boulevard were closed to traffic.

Also closed were the eastbound I-595 ramp to northbound I-95, the northbound I-95 on-ramp from Broward Boulevard, and the northbound I-95 on-ramp from Davie Boulevard.

Those heading to Fort Lauderdale-Hollywood International Airport were advised to take the Turnpike to I-595 and then head east.
